WebIf you don't have dental insurance, you pay 100% of the cost of all services and procedures. To get an idea of what you'll pay, here are the average costs of common dental procedures: Basic dental cleaning —$75–$200 1. Panoramic X-rays —$100–$200 2. Metal crown —$500–$2,000 per tooth 3. Simple tooth extraction —$75–$250 4. WebApr 10, 2024 · A maximum benefit is a feature typically associated with dental PPO insurance and dental indemnity plans. The maximum benefit is a dollar value that represents the most an insurance plan will pay for your dental care in a year. WebThe term, “full coverage” means you’re getting benefits for a lot of different types of dental treatments and procedures. For example, you may have coverage for more costly things like root canals, bridges, and implants, as well as coverage for your . Full coverage does not mean your plan covers 100% of all costs, however.

WebJul 19, 2024 · The cost of one dental implant with a porcelain crown is about $4,800, with prices ranging from $3,500 to $6,700. That cost covers the implant device and its surgical placement. The average cost for a full mouth of implants is around $43,000 and may be as much as $56,000. A newer implant option is a one-piece device made entirely of …
